Part II: Problems Problem1 Brentwood Associates uses a job-order costing system and applies overhead on the basis of direct labor hours. At the beginning of the year, management estimated that 26,000 direct labor hours would be worked and $1,300,000 of manufacturing overhead costs would be incurred During the year, the company actually worked 24,000 direct labor hours and incurred the following manufacturing costs: Direct materials used in productiorn Direct labor Indirect labor Indirect materials Insurance Utilities Repairs and Maintentance Depreciation $1,240,000 1,800,000 280,000 220,000 150,000 190,000 180,000 320,000 Required: 1. Calculate the predetermined overhead application rate for the year 2. Determine the amount of manufacturing overhead applied to work in process during the year. 3. Determine the amount of underapplied or overapplied overhead for the year
